Explanation:

We are looking for a if and only if statement for a bioconditional.

There is only one such choice:

The equation x+3=9 is true if and only if x=6.

We only know information about the triangle's angles, and nothing about their sides. AAA (angle-angle-angle) is not enough information to conclude congruence. It is enough for proving it to be similar.
